Unibet extends CPL T-20 cricket partnership

unibet

European sports betting operator Unibet has confirmed that it has extended its betting partnership of cricket’s ‘HERO Caribbean Premier League’ (CPL) for a further two years.

Unibet had been announced official betting partner of the CPL T-20 championship in May 2015.

The continued partnership will see the bookmaker maintain its shirt sponsorship of the St Lucia Zouks franchise, which includes CPL star players Darren Sammy, Shane Watson and Johnson Charles.

Renewing its sponsorship, Unibet marketing stated that it would enhance CPL promotions and offers, making the bookmaker the best place for players to wager on the T-20 championship.

Pete Russell, the Chief Operating Officer of HERO Caribbean Premier League, said: “The CPL is delighted to extend our partnership with Unibet as the tournament’s official betting partner and we look forward to working closely with them over the next two years.”

Unibet United Kingdom Marketing Manager Chris Watson commented on the partnership extension: “We are passionate about cricket at Unibet, and as ‘The Biggest Party in Sport’, the CPL perfectly matches our friendly, passionate and expert brand values.”
